VMware虚拟机安装无法识别解决方案
虚拟机vmware安装识别不了

首页 2025-02-18 05:33:00



虚拟机VMware安装识别不了?全面解析与高效解决方案 在信息技术飞速发展的今天,虚拟化技术已经成为企业数据中心和个人开发者不可或缺的一部分

    VMware作为虚拟化领域的领航者,提供了强大的虚拟机管理功能,使得用户能够在单一物理机上运行多个操作系统

    然而,在实际使用过程中,不少用户会遇到虚拟机VMware安装识别不了的问题,这不仅影响了工作效率,还可能带来一系列后续的技术挑战

    本文将深入探讨这一问题的成因,并提供一系列高效解决方案,帮助用户迅速排除故障,恢复虚拟机的正常运行

     一、问题概述 虚拟机VMware安装识别不了,通常表现为在安装或启动虚拟机时,VMware Workstation、Fusion或ESXi等管理程序无法正确识别或加载虚拟机文件(如.vmx文件)、硬盘镜像(如.vmdk文件)或其他必要的配置文件

    这一问题可能源于多种因素,包括但不限于软件兼容性问题、硬件配置限制、文件损坏、权限设置不当以及VMware软件本身的bug

     二、常见原因分析 1.软件版本不兼容 - VMware软件与操作系统版本不兼容是导致识别问题的常见原因之一

    例如,较新版本的VMware可能不支持较旧的操作系统,反之亦然

     - 此外,如果虚拟机操作系统安装镜像与VMware支持的版本不符,也可能导致无法识别

     2.硬件配置限制 - 虚拟机配置要求超出了宿主机的物理硬件限制,如CPU指令集不支持、内存不足或磁盘空间不足等

     - BIOS/UEFI设置中的虚拟化技术(如Intel VT-x或AMD-V)未启用,也会影响VMware对虚拟机的识别

     3.文件损坏或缺失 - 虚拟机配置文件(.vmx)、硬盘文件(.vmdk)等关键文件损坏或丢失,会导致VMware无法正确加载虚拟机

     - 文件路径中包含特殊字符或非英文字符,也可能引起识别问题

     4.权限设置不当 - 虚拟机文件所在的文件夹权限设置不正确,使得VMware进程无法访问这些文件

     - 在Linux系统上,SELinux或AppArmor等安全模块可能阻止VMware访问虚拟机文件

     5.VMware软件问题 - VMware软件本身存在bug或安装不完整,影响对虚拟机的识别能力

     - 注册表项损坏或配置错误也可能导致此类问题

     三、高效解决方案 针对上述原因,以下提供一系列高效解决方案,旨在帮助用户快速定位并解决虚拟机VMware安装识别不了的问题

     1.检查软件版本兼容性 - 确认VMware软件版本与操作系统版本、虚拟机操作系统镜像的兼容性

     - 访问VMware官方网站,查阅最新的兼容性指南和更新日志

     - 如需,升级VMware软件或更换适合的虚拟机操作系统镜像

     2.调整硬件配置 - 检查宿主机的硬件配置,确保满足虚拟机的最低要求

     - 进入BIOS/UEFI设置,确保虚拟化技术(Intel VT-x/EPT或AMD-V/RVI)已启用

     - 根据需要调整虚拟机的内存分配和磁盘空间设置

     3.修复或恢复文件 - 检查虚拟机文件是否完整,尝试从备份中恢复损坏的文件

     - 确保虚拟机文件存储路径中不包含特殊字符或非英文字符

     - 使用VMware提供的工具(如vmware-cmd或vmkfstools)检查和修复虚拟机文件

     4.调整权限设置 - 在Windows系统上,右键点击虚拟机文件夹,选择“属性”,在“安全”选项卡中确保当前用户账户拥有足够的访问权限

     - 在Linux系统上,使用`chmod`和`chown`命令调整文件夹和文件的权限和所有权

     - 暂时禁用SELinux或AppArmor,检查是否解决了问题(注意:长期禁用可能带来安全风险)

     5.重新安装或修复VMware软件 - 卸载VMware软件,清理注册表项(Windows)或配置文件(Linux),然后重新安装最新版本

     - 使用VMware提供的修复工具或安装程序中的修复选项

     - 检查是否有可用的VMware更新补丁,并应用它们

     6.日志文件分析 - 查看VMware的日志文件(通常位于虚拟机文件夹中的`vmware.log`或宿主机的系统日志中),寻找错误提示和相关信息

     - 根据日志中的错误代码和信息,搜索VMware官方知识库或社区论坛,获取针对性的解决方案

     7.创建新虚拟机测试 - 尝试使用VMware创建一个新的虚拟机,并配置相同的操作系统和硬件配置,以验证是否为特定虚拟机文件的问题

     - 如果新虚拟机能够成功安装和运行,考虑将旧虚拟机的重要数据迁移到新虚拟机中

     8.联系技术支持 - 如果上述方法均未能解决问题,建议联系VMware官方技术支持团队,提供详细的错误描述、日志文件和相关配置信息

     - 技术支持团队将能够提供更专业的诊断和建议,帮助用户解决复杂的技术难题

     四、预防措施 为了避免虚拟机VMware安装识别不了的问题再次发生,建议采取以下预防措施: - 定期备份虚拟机文件:定期备份虚拟机配置文件和硬盘文件,以防文件损坏或丢失

     - 保持软件更新:定期检查并更新VMware软件至最新版本,以获取最新的功能和安全修复

     - 监控硬件状态:定期监控宿主机的硬件状态,确保硬件配置满足虚拟机的运行需求

     - 权限管理:合理设置虚拟机文件夹的权限,避免权限设置不当导致的访问问题

     - 日志审查:定期检查VMware日志文件,及时发现并解决潜在问题

     五、结语 虚拟机VMware安装识别不了的问题虽然复杂多变,但通过系统的分析和高效的解决方案,大多数问题都能得到妥善解决

    本文提供的解决策略不仅能够帮助用户快速定位问题根源,还能指导用户采取有效的预防措施,降低未来发生类似问题的风险

    在虚拟化技术日益普及的今天,掌握这些技能对于提升工作效率、保障数据安全具有重要意义

    希望本文能成为广大VMware用户解决此类问题的有力助手

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道